HS Football, Week 7: Mistakes sink M.V.C. in 37-14 loss to Palma

The Palma High Chieftains took advantage of a handful of M.V.C. errors in the first half to rout the Mustangs, 37-14, in the teams’ Monterey Bay League Gabilan division game at Rabobank Stadium in Salinas.

Girls CCS Water Polo: Aptos' season ends in D-II quarterfinals

No. 6 Aptos High and No. 3 Menlo were about as even as possible through three quarters of their CCS Division II quarterfinal match, heading into the fourth in a 4-4 tie. But the Knights made more plays down the stretch to eliminate the Mariners in a 7-5 victory on Saturday in Aptos.
